aitoearn-auth.guard.ts
根目录 / project / aitoearn-backend / libs / aitoearn-auth / src / aitoearn-auth.guard.ts
1 import {
2 CanActivate,
3 ExecutionContext,
4 Inject,
5 Injectable,
6 Logger,
7 UnauthorizedException,
8 } from '@nestjs/common'
9 import { Reflector } from '@nestjs/core'
10 import { JwtService } from '@nestjs/jwt'
11 import { AITOEARN_AUTH_OPTIONS, AitoearnAuthOptions, TokenPayload } from './aitoearn-auth.config'
12 import { API_KEY_HEADER_KEY, IS_INTERNAL_KEY, IS_PUBLIC_KEY } from './aitoearn-auth.constants'
13
14 @Injectable()
15 export class AitoearnAuthGuard implements CanActivate {
16 private readonly logger = new Logger(AitoearnAuthGuard.name)
17 private readonly reflector = new Reflector()
18 constructor(
19 private readonly jwtService: JwtService,
20 @Inject(AITOEARN_AUTH_OPTIONS)
21 private readonly options: AitoearnAuthOptions,
22 ) {}
23
24 async canActivate(context: ExecutionContext): Promise<boolean> {
25 const isPublic = this.reflector.getAllAndOverride<boolean>(IS_PUBLIC_KEY, [
26 context.getHandler(),
27 context.getClass(),
28 ])
29 const isInternal = this.reflector.getAllAndOverride<boolean>(IS_INTERNAL_KEY, [
30 context.getHandler(),
31 context.getClass(),
32 ])
33
34 const request = context.switchToHttp().getRequest()
35
36 if (isInternal) {
37 const token = this.extractTokenFromHeader(request)
38 if (token === this.options.internalToken) {
39 return true
40 }
41 throw new UnauthorizedException()
42 }
43
44 // 1. API Key 认证(x-api-key,既有行为,对所有路由生效)
45 const apiKey = request.headers['x-api-key'] as string | undefined
46 if (apiKey) {
47 await this.resolveApiKey(request, apiKey)
48 return true
49 }
50
51 // 2. 额外声明的 header(@ApiKeyHeader)按 API Key 解析
52 const apiKeyHeader = this.reflector.getAllAndOverride<string>(API_KEY_HEADER_KEY, [
53 context.getHandler(),
54 context.getClass(),
55 ])
56 if (apiKeyHeader) {
57 // Authorization 特殊处理:优先按 JWT 校验,失败再兜底按 API Key 解析
58 if (apiKeyHeader.toLowerCase() === 'authorization') {
59 const token = this.extractTokenFromHeader(request)
60 if (token && token !== this.options.internalToken) {
61 if (await this.tryJwt(request, token)) {
62 return true
63 }
64 await this.resolveApiKey(request, token)
65 return true
66 }
67 }
68 else {
69 const headerValue = request.headers[apiKeyHeader.toLowerCase()] as string | undefined
70 if (headerValue) {
71 await this.resolveApiKey(request, headerValue)
72 return true
73 }
74 }
75 }
76
77 // 3. Bearer Token 认证(默认 JWT 路径)
78 const token = this.extractTokenFromHeader(request)
79 if (!token) {
80 if (isPublic) {
81 return true
82 }
83 throw new UnauthorizedException()
84 }
85
86 if (token === this.options.internalToken) {
87 return true
88 }
89
90 if (await this.tryJwt(request, token)) {
91 return true
92 }
93
94 if (isPublic) {
95 return true
96 }
97 throw new UnauthorizedException()
98 }
99
100 private async resolveApiKey(request: any, apiKey: string): Promise<void> {
101 if (!this.options.getTokenInfoByApiKey) {
102 throw new UnauthorizedException()
103 }
104 request['user'] = await this.options.getTokenInfoByApiKey(apiKey)
105 }
106
107 private async tryJwt(request: any, token: string): Promise<boolean> {
108 try {
109 const payload = await this.jwtService.verifyAsync<TokenPayload>(token, {
110 secret: this.options.secret,
111 })
112 request['user'] = await this.options.getTokenInfo(payload)
113 return true
114 }
115 catch (error) {
116 this.logger.debug({
117 message: 'token验证失败',
118 error,
119 })
120 return false
121 }
122 }
123
124 private extractTokenFromHeader(request: any): string | undefined {
125 const [type, token] = request.headers.authorization?.split(' ') ?? []
126 return type === 'Bearer' ? token : undefined
127 }
128 }
